People Search Sites Reunion.com, Wink Agree to Merger

Authored by Mark Hefflinger on November 3, 2008 - 8:04am.

Los Angeles - Online social network and search service Reunion.com and people search engine Wink.com announced on Monday that they have agreed to merge, and will launch an entirely new brand and website early next year.

Financial terms of the transaction were not disclosed.

Reunion.com and Wink said that the combined company will provide users with access to a total of more than 700 million profiles spanning social network, online communities and other sources.

Launched in 2002, Los Angeles-based Reunion.com has over 50 million members, and counts more than 12 million unique monthly visitors.

Wink provides access to more than 500 million online profiles through its people search engine.

"This deal is the next step in our company's evolution to bring a groundbreaking mix of people search services to consumers across multiple online networks," said Jeffrey Tinsley, founder and CEO of Reunion.com.

"With five billion searches across the Web each month, the people search vertical is bigger than any other. Our goal is to create the definitive people search service that creates a single source for connecting with people."
